Within a reasonable time not to exceed 30 days from the date the hearing is closed, the hearing officer shall submit a written report to the City Clerk. Such report shall contain a summary of the evidence considered and state the hearing officer's findings, conclusions, and recommendations. The report shall also contain a proposed decision in the matter. All such reports filed with the City Clerk shall be matters of public record. A copy of each such report of proposed decision shall be mailed by certified mail, or personally delivered, to the applicant/appellant on the date it is filed with the City Clerk, and a further copy shall be sent to the City department, board, or commission most directly concerned with the subject of the report.
